
This episode discusses the wrongful conviction of Sandy Shaw, who spent 21 years in prison for a murder she didn't commit.
Part 2 of 2. Sandy Shaw was known as the 'Show and Tell Killer,' and a jury convicted her of a murder she didn't commit. Yet, she still spent 21 years in prison. We will discuss her tumultuous life, the horrific chain of events that led to her conviction, and how she came out on the other side.
